What makes Charlotte special for flooring

Charlotte wintertimes are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in indoor moisture throughout the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Timber relocates with wetness, floor tile settings up require growth joints, and adhesives fall short if mounted in a damp crawlspace. Areas include their very own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es typically h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your indoor relative mo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ll discuss acclimation in days, not hours. If they never pull out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us fixing: various abilities, different mindsets

Many companies market themselves as a flooring installation service. Less are strong at flooring repair. The skill overlap isn't ideal, and this matters if your task straddles both worlds.

  • Installation is choreography. The team intends shifts, startles joints, establishes development spaces, and sequences rooms to keep your family functional. They bring performance and uniformity throughout hundreds or countless square feet.
  • Repair is investigative work. It calls for determining the source of movement, dampness, or glue failure prior to dealing with the surface area. A real flooring repair specialist in Charlotte is worth their price. The most effective installers value them, also, and will certainly subcontract complicated repair services when needed.

When you veterinarian a flooring company in Charlotte, request instances of both. Request photos of a challenging staircase nosing setup and also a fixing where they tied brand-new boards into a present area without telegraphing the spot. You'll discover promptly whether they appreciate both crafts.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space

Every material does well in certain conditions and falls short in others. Take into consideration lived truth before style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, however it requires st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A reliable flooring installation service in Charlotte will adv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Solid white oak executes far better than maple in this climate because it relocates extra naturally. Prefinished crafted wood can be a much safer selection over a slab or over spaces with prospective moisture. If you desire site-finished floorings, budget for dust control and an added day or two of cure time.

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has taken over permanently reasons. It's tolerant of dampness, handles pet dog nails, and sets up quick. The downside is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The distinction between a bargain set up and a pro LVP job is the leveling preparation. The guarantee language on numerous LVP brands calls for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ask just how your service provider procedures and attains that.

Tile is sturdy, yet it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have contraction splits and crinkled sides, and older homes may have lively joists. The repair is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where ideal, and motion joints in large run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ks easy due to the fact that a pro did the complicated layout mathematics before blending the first set of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a sensible cost. The mistakes rem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pet dogs, miss fundamental r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ings produces compression marks that relieve with time, however the best pad assists. A great installer will prepare seam placement far from rush hour and take into consideration the pile direction in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et goods show up sometimes in basements and workshops. Right here, wetness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ening tells you whether adhesive will surv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A specialist that gl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The makeup of a solid estimate

Estimates reveal exactly how a flooring company believes. Two bids can look similar in complete however differ considerably in what they consist of. Clearness conserves disagreements later.

Look for line products that detail subfloor preparation, product acclimation, changes, baseboards or shoe molding, furniture mo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ote just cla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ful quote might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ling compound with device price, a new reducer at the cooking area limit, and replacement of 3 broken ceramic t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.

Ask just how they manage unknowns. A sincere service provider will certainly discuss that they can not see under existing flooring until demo, after that price quote an array for typical disc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for authorizing extras and provide images pr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or prep than any type of various other reason. Floors rely on what's below.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take dampness readings at a number of factors. It's common to locate the front rooms completely dry and the back spaces boosted due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the foundation. Repair the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Several older residences slope a little towards the center. That's not a flaw if it corresponds.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the solution may be fining sand down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ion matter. An excellent team chooses brands they understand and designates a lead that has actually put loads of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ness reduction primer might be called for. The cost injures upfront, yet it's economical insurance coverage cont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ped crafted wood. Lots of failings turn up between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the piece gets up and starts pushing vapor.

Warranties that suggest something

A warranty is only as good as the company behind it. Maker guarantees usually exclude installation errors, and they call for the installer to adhere to the publication. Maintain your documentation. Save pictures of adjustment heaps, moisture analyses, and the underlayment used. Good professionals record their process and share it with you.

Labor warranties for flooring repair and setup in Charlotte commonly range from one to three years. Some companies supply longer for certain items they understand well. Review the exclusions. Seasonal spaces in hardwood are not an issue, yet gross cupping most likely is if moisture control remains in location. Adhesive failures can be on the installer, the product, or the substrate. A pro will go back to diagnose and not condemn the item blindly. That openness is part of what you're paying for.

What a strong first browse through looks like

The very first site go to establishes the tone. Expect questions regarding your house schedule, family pets, and the number of people will certainly be walking through the rooms throughout and after set up. A contractor needs to determine every space, not just eyeball square footage, and must check a/c regist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est eliminating doors prior to mount or intend to cut them after if new floor height demands it.

They must chat through adjustment. In summer season, it prevails to allow hardwood professional flooring contractors rest for at the very least five to 7 days in the conditioned area. LVP producers often specify a 48-hour acclimation duration, but real problems determine prudence. The most effective groups will position a hygrometer in the space and go for a consistent range prior to opening up cartons.

If the task involves redecorating, ask exactly how they manage d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ic obstacles make a large distinction.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es cure fa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ne finishes are typically the practical option if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repair work the wise way

Floors stop working for reasons, and the solution needs to address the reason initially. Cupped wood near a back door usually points to mo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ile usually traces back to poor co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will draw a suspect ceramic t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eals,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building adhesive into joints, and using shims sensibly minimizes sound without wrecking completed flooring. If the only access is from above, be sincere concerning expectations.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ted locations, but an old flooring system might still talk a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er understands just how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items require cutting and heat to launch glue. Matching ceased l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ve an extra carton if you can.

Small selections that repay big

A few sensible decisions make life less complicated after the staff leaves. Request classified touch-up stain or complete for wood, and an extra quart of matching paint for walls. Save a collection of cement, caulk, and a few added 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the specific product code and batch number, after that put two or 3 planks away. Record where transitions land with a fast phone video before the base footwear takes place,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have large pets, take into consideration a satin or matte surface on wood to conceal scratches and choose larger sl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, pick grout with stain resistance and maintain the extra in case of future patching. These details set you back little and expand the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

Is it better to have hardwood or laminate flooring?

Hardwood offers longer lifespan and can be refinished multiple times. Laminate is more affordable and resists surface scratches better. Hardwood performs better for long-term value, while laminate suits budget-conscious or high-traffic spaces. Moisture sensitivity is higher with hardwood.

How much is 1000 sq ft of flooring?

Material costs typically range from $2 to $10 per square foot depending on type. For 1,000 square feet, materials alone usually cost $2,000–$10,000. Installed costs commonly range from $4,000 to $15,000 including labor and prep. Subfloor repairs can increase totals.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

What floor never goes out of style?

Natural hardwood in neutral tones is considered timeless. Narrow or medium plank widths age better than extreme trends. Matte finishes tend to remain visually relevant longer than high gloss. Simplicity contributes to long-term appeal.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
